Frequently Asked Questions
Can I have a smart gate for my pool?
Yes, but it must integrate with IBC/IRC pool code. The gate must self-close and self-latch, with the release mechanism at least 54 inches high. Modern IoT latches can provide access logs and remote status alerts, meeting 2026 liability standards for Wisconsin homeowners.
Is a standard fence strong enough for our wind?
No. A 115 MPH V-ult wind load rating dictates engineering. Standard 8-foot post spacing often fails. We use 6-foot spacing with concrete footings and wind-rated brackets to withstand peak storm season gusts, per ASCE 7-22 standards.
What are my legal duties when replacing a shared fence in Kimberly?
Wisconsin Statute 90.03, the 'Good Neighbor' fence law, requires you to provide adjoining owners written notice before replacing a shared boundary fence. As of 2026, this notification must be sent via certified mail at least 15 days prior to starting work.
Why do fence posts in Kimberly Heights fail so often?
Posts fail because they are not set below the 48-inch frost line. Frost heave in our soil can lift a shallow footing by several inches each winter, cracking posts and racking panels. IRC Section R403 requires footings to extend below this depth to prevent structural movement.
What fence materials work best with Kimberly's soil?
With moderate soil corrosivity and slight termite risk, pressure-treated pine or vinyl are suitable. Use hot-dip galvanized or stainless-steel fasteners to prevent rust streaks. Incompatible materials will degrade faster, increasing long-term maintenance costs.

What are the height and placement rules for a fence in Kimberly?
Zoning limits are 4 feet high in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ards. A 0-foot setback allows installation on the property line. For corner lots, you must maintain a clear 'sight triangle' at intersections, especially near I-41, where visibility for traffic is critical.
What is required before digging fence post holes?
You must contact Diggers Hotline (811) at least three business days before digging. Hitting a utility line in Kimberly Heights is a major liability. We manage all Diggers Hotline tickets and pull the required permit from the Kimberly Inspection Office to ensure compliance.
